The Historical Genesis: The Soviet Pursuit of Excellence
The story of testosterone steroids in Russia began in earnest during the middle of the 20th century. Following World War II, the Soviet Union (USSR) used sports as a theatre for ideological dominance. The objective was easy: to show that the socialist system produced exceptional human beings.
As early as the 1950s, Soviet doctors started experimenting with exogenous testosterone. Throughout the 1952 and 1954 weight-lifting champions, international observers noted the unprecedented strength gains of Soviet athletes. It was throughout this period that Dr. John Ziegler, Магазин стероидов в России the US group doctor, Купить настоящие стероиды в России supposedly discovered from a Soviet associate that they were using testosterone injections. This realization triggered the "arms race" of efficiency improvement, resulting in the advancement of Dianabol in the West.
The Modern Era and Systemic Doping Scandals
Quick forward to the 21st century, and the narrative developed from private use to accusations of state-sponsored programs. The most significant shift in international understanding happened following the 2014 Sochi Winter Olympics.
The subsequent "McLaren Report" and the testament of Dr. Grigory Rodchenkov, Купить стероиды в Санкт-Петербурге the former head of Russia's national anti-doping lab, exposed an advanced system designed to prevent screening protocols. This consisted of making use of the "Duchess cocktail"-- a mixture of 3 anabolic steroids (Metenolone, Trenbolone, and Oxandrolone) liquified in alcohol to shorten the detection window.

From a useful perspective, it is essential to resolve the medical truth of utilizing exogenous testosterone and synthetic derivatives. While they increase protein synthesis and muscle mass, the physiological expense can be high.
Possible Side Effects Include:
Cardiovascular Strain: Increased LDL cholesterol, hypertension, and left ventricular hypertrophy (enhancement of the heart).Hormonal Imbalance: Suppression of natural testosterone production, causing testicular atrophy and potential infertility.Hepatic Stress: Oral C-17 alpha-alkylated steroids can trigger substantial liver toxicity and even growths.Mental Effects: Mood swings, increased hostility (frequently called "roid rage"), and potential for Купить легальные стероиды для набора массы в России dependence.International Fallout and WADA Bans

3. What is the "Duchess Cocktail"?
It was a particular mixture of three anabolic steroids-- metenolone, trenbolone, and oxandrolone-- established by Dr. Grigory Rodchenkov. It was designed to be absorbed through the mouth's mucous membranes when mixed with alcohol (Chivas Regal for males, Martini vermouth for women) to reduce the detection window throughout drug tests.
4. Is natural testosterone production affected by steroid use?
Yes. When a person introduces artificial testosterone into their body, the endocrine system closes down its own natural production via a negative feedback loop. This can result in long-lasting hormone issues once the external source is terminated.
